
The highly-anticipated addition to Robert Mckee's volume of works that continue to serve as a writer's guide to becoming an expert in the art of storytelling. Following the massive success of his recent works Dialogue and Character, the most sought-after screenwriting lecturer shares his insights on one of the most demanding yet crucial genres of storytelling: action. ACTION explores the ways that a modern-day writer can successfully invent an action sequence that stands apart on its own in a world that has become saturated with clich s. McKee and el-Wakil guide the writer to successful originality by deconstructing the genre, illuminating the challenges, and, more importantly, demonstrating how to overcome them. Throughout the book, they illustrate the principles of action with precision and clarity by referencing some of the most popular movies we have come to known...
